1. 程式人生 > >C#中使用OracleConnection連線Oracle11g資料庫

C#中使用OracleConnection連線Oracle11g資料庫

            string connstr = "data source=orcl;User Id =scott;Password =tiger";
            OracleConnection conn = new OracleConnection(connstr);
            conn.Open();
            string sql = "select * from emp";
            OracleCommand commd = new OracleCommand(sql,conn);
            OracleDataAdapter adpter = new OracleDataAdapter(commd);
            DataTable table = new DataTable();
            adpter.Fill(table);
            dataGridView1.DataSource = table;

忘記conn.Open() 一直提示無效操作,連線關閉。以後要注意了,基本的東西不能忘呀。。。。。。。

相關推薦

C#使用OracleConnection連線Oracle11g資料庫

string connstr = "data source=orcl;User Id =scott;Password =tiger"; OracleCo

C#判斷SQL Server資料庫是否連線成功

using System.Data; using System.Data.SqlClient; SqlConnection conn = new SqlConnection(); if (conn.State == ConnectionSt

[技巧]C++如何連線兩個char陣列

問題: 因為char陣列不以‘\0’結尾,所以連線兩個char型陣列無法直接使用strcat等函式,可以採用sprintf函式 string s; char a1[] = {'A', 'B',

C++ API方式連線mysql資料庫實現增刪改查

轉自 http://www.bitscn.com/pdb/mysql/201407/226252.html 一、環境配置 1,裝好mysql,新建一個C++控制檯工程(從最簡單的弄起,這個會了,可以往任何c++工程移植),在vs2010中設定,工程--屬性--VC++目

實現在C#通過語句,查詢資料庫的資料

        SqlConnection con = null; //建立SqlConnection 的物件         &n

C#連線超時功能的TcpClient類

關於TcpClient 類在C#中對於操作TCP connection是非常方便的,非常地好! 但是有一點就是,這個類對於CONNECT操作沒有設定超時! 系統預設的是60秒的超時,這明顯過於地長。 我們可以重新去用Thread的join這個帶引數的執行緒

C#-繼承IDbConnection連線不同資料庫,通用的DbHelper(2)

在《C#-繼承IDbConnection連線不同資料庫,通用的DbHelper(1)》之後,感覺和原來的DbHelper使用方法不同,為了採用統一的parameter方法,進行了以下修改。 增加以下類 1. Parameters.cs # 帶引

c#使用2013連線Oracle資料庫

using System; using System.Collections.Generic; using System.Linq; using System.Text; using System.T

C#使用EF連線PGSql資料庫

前言 由於專案需要,使用到了PGSql資料庫,說實話這是第一次接觸並且聽說PGSql(PostgreSQL)關係型資料庫,之前一直使用的都是SqlServer,一頭霧水的各種找資源,終於將PGSql與C#的EF連線起來,可以像使用SQLServer一樣使用PGSql了。 PGSql目前有一個pgAdmin

MyEcplisejava連線MySQL資料庫的java.lang.NoClassDefFoundError: org/aspectj/lang/Signature問題

我用的是ecplise3.2+myecplise5.1.1+Tomcat 5.0+MySQL5.0+jdk1.5新建專案名為Test,然後在裡面新建了mysql.html和mysql.jsp功能是把mysql.html寫的東西傳到mysql.jsp中程式如下:(2.1)mysql.html <html

C++使用ADO連線MySql資料庫

1.資料庫技術發展 ODBC->DAO->RDO->ADOOLE DB 2.ADO中包含了七個物件成員          Connection用於管理資料庫的連線          Command包含sql命令          RecordSet用來儲

C/C++使用ODBC連線MSSQL資料庫

前幾天在研究C/C++連結MSSQL資料的方法,前前後後在網上找了不少的文章,大多數文章都沒法真正的解決入門新手的全部疑惑,所以在此整理一下自己整個連線資料庫的過程,希望能幫到有需要的人。 一、首先是MSSQL server的安裝,相信有不少同學會卡在這邊。我安裝的是MS

VS 引用連線mysql資料庫失敗 報錯:">LINK : fatal error LNK1104: 無法開啟檔案“libmysql.lib”

出現此類問題時,首先需要檢查一下專案配置檔案: 專案檔案——》右鍵屬性 (1)檢查VC++目錄配置配置均完成! (2)檢查連結器——》輸入配置方法如下:     若檢查以上錯誤均完成了,錯誤報錯原因就是不是配置專案的原因,開啟專案路徑檢查路徑下是否有如下兩個檔案“libmys

tomcat web應用 無法連線資料庫的問題

1、直接將李陽瘋狂javaee中的web應用拖到tomcat的webapps裡出現了這個問題driver url user pass都正確的情況下,連線不上資料庫:原因:經過多次實驗,發現了是tomcat中lib和web app 的lib 裡的sql driver 重複了,刪

使用PL/SQL軟體連線oracle11g資料庫

問題發生的場景:        在本地伺服器完成oracle11g安裝後,配置NET MANAGER對資料庫的監聽程式進行了重新配置,並經過測試後,連線正常。同時使用sqlplus進行資料庫登陸也正常。 但是在使用pl/sql對資料庫進行連線時候出現了 ORA-12154:

C#winform直接連線SQL資料庫mdf檔案

1.首先mdf檔案必須是SQLServer2008及以下資料庫,最好是2005版本的資料庫 2.將mdf檔案這裡以資料庫檔案“Test.mdf”為例,放於與程式Bin資料夾同文件夾下 3.在Program.cs檔案中,Main()方法下,新增如下程式碼 string dat

linux下c++使用occi連線oracle資料庫步驟,及出現的問題和解決

1. 所需安裝包 (64 位 ) oracle-instantclient-basic-10.2.0.3-1.x86_64.rpm oracle-instantclient-devel-10.2.0.3-1.x86_64.rpm 2. 安裝 安裝後,庫檔案路

C# ASP.NET連線PostgreSQL 資料庫DBHelper

public class PGDBHelper { public static string pgsqlConnection = ConfigurationManager.C

java工程如何連線redis資料庫

java連線redis資料庫主要使用Jedis這麼一個jar包,Jedis是Redis官方推薦的用於java訪問redis的客戶端,如果你的是maven工程,在pom.xml檔案新增以下依賴: &l

Eclipsehibernate連線mySQL資料庫練習

下面開始搭建hibernate資料庫:1.在eclipse中新建Java project專案,名稱為:hibernateTest。右擊專案名稱,點選property,選擇Java Build Path,加入需要匯入的JAR包。2.在src資料夾下,新建hibernate.cfg.xml配置檔案,(連線資料庫的